Guy Doleman was a consummate character actor with a versatile screen presence and a knack for inhabiting a diverse array of roles. Born in New Zealand, Doleman made his mark in British and Australian cinema, bringing a captivating intensity and depth to both dramatic and genre films. One of Doleman's most iconic performances was as the enigmatic Number Two in the cult classic television series "The Prisoner." His brooding, enigmatic portrayal of the mysterious authority figure perfectly encapsulated the show's themes of individuality and control, cementing his status as a beloved figure in the annals of small-screen history. Doleman's ability to convey a sense of quiet menace and unsettling ambiguity made him a natural fit for complex, morally ambiguous characters. Beyond "The Prisoner," Doleman's filmography is a tapestry of acclaimed performances across a range of genres. From the gritty war drama "The Biggest Battle" to the Cold War espionage thriller "Enigma," he showcased his versatility and command of the screen. Doleman's collaborations with Michael Caine in the Harry Palmer spy films, where he played the stoic Colonel Ross, further solidified his reputation as a skilled character actor who could hold his own against leading men. Across his diverse body of work, Guy Doleman left an indelible mark on cinema, his talent and screen presence captivating audiences for decades.
